About

Danny J. Collier Jr. is a litigation attorney with 15 years of legal experience, practicing at Luther, Collier, Hodges & Cash, LLP in Mobile, AL. He earned a B.A. from University of South Alabama in 1991 and a J.D. from University of Mississippi School of Law in 1994. He is admitted to practice in Mississippi (since 2010) and Alabama (since 1996). His practice encompasses litigation, construction and development, and personal injury,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
